Come svuotare i file di registro di sistema su Raspberry Pi

Come svuotare i file di registro di sistema su Raspberry Pi

Nei sistemi basati su Linux come Raspberry Pi, sono presenti i file di registro di sistema che contengono il processo, i dettagli di accesso e altre azioni. Nel tempo il contenuto all'interno dei file di registro continua ad aumentare e acquisisce spazio sul disco. Per Raspberry Pi (mini-computer), è importante continuare a svuotare lo spazio sul disco in modo che il sistema non esaurisca lo spazio.

Se vuoi liberare un po 'di spazio sul tuo Raspberry Pi, allora è una buona idea per i file di registro di sistema vuoti e questo articolo è una guida su come farlo.

Come visualizzare i file di registro di sistema in Raspberry Pi

Nel sistema Raspberry Pi, tutti i file di registro sono presenti in /var/log directory. Quindi, per visualizzare i file di registro di sistema, modificare la directory in /var/log:

CD /var /log


Quindi usando il ls comando, è possibile visualizzare l'elenco completo dei file di registro:

ls


File di registro di sistema vuoti su Raspberry Pi

Esistono quattro metodi per i file di registro di sistema vuoti su Raspberry Pi, che sono i seguenti:

    • Usando il comando troncate
    • Usando> comando
    • Usando il comando Echo
    • Comando usando /dev /null

Metodo 1: usando il comando troncate

Il primo metodo per svuotare i file di registro di sistema è utilizzando il "troncare" comando. Troncing un file significa svuotare/eliminare tutto il suo contenuto per fare le dimensioni del file 0 kb.

"troncare" Il comando viene utilizzato principalmente per svuotare i file di registro di sistema. La sintassi per il comando Truncate è menzionata di seguito:

sudo truncate -s 0


Per esempio; Qui, voglio rimuovere il contenuto del AUTH.tronco d'albero file.


Per troncare o svuotare questo file ho eseguito il troncare comando come mostrato di seguito:

sudo truncate -s 0 autentica.tronco d'albero



Dopo aver eseguito il comando sopra ora quando ho aperto il file, puoi vedere che è vuoto:

Metodo 2: usando> comando

L'utente Raspberry Pi può anche utilizzare ">" Comando con il nome del file di registro di sistema per svuotare un file di registro sul sistema. Tuttavia, per svuotare il file di registro attraverso ">", Gli utenti devono passare alla root prima di applicare il comando.

Qui, voglio svuotare il file syslog che è evidenziato nell'immagine qui sotto. Quindi in primo luogo, visualizziamo il /var/log Directory in cui sono presenti tutti i nostri file di registro di sistema:

ls



Il file syslog apparirà qualcosa come mostrato nell'immagine qui sotto:


Ora passiamo all'utente root ed eliminiamo il file syslog seguendo i comandi di seguito:

sudo su root


Tipo:

> syslog



Per verificare, aprire il file syslog file usando nano editor è vuoto:

Metodo 3: usando il comando Echo

Terzo nella nostra lista è il comando echo, usando il eco comando, si può anche svuotare il file di registro di sistema. Segui la sintassi del comando Echo di seguito:

Echo>


Ricorda di utilizzare questo comando che l'utente deve avere privilegi di root o puoi semplicemente passare all'utente root utilizzando sudo su comando.

Per esempio:

echo> utente.tronco d'albero



Metodo 4: utilizzo /dev /null comando

L'ultimo metodo sull'elenco per svuotare i file di registro di sistema su Raspberry Pi è utilizzando il /dev/noioso comando insieme al gatto comando. /dev/null è un file speciale sul sistema basato su Linux come Raspberry Pi, ma tutto ciò che viene eliminato utilizzando /dev/null non può essere recuperato. Segui la sintassi di seguito per questo metodo per svuotare i file di registro di sistema su Raspberry Pi.

Cat /Dev /Null>


Per esempio:

Cat /Dev /Null> Avvio.tronco d'albero




In questo modo, puoi svuotare qualsiasi file di registro di sistema che desideri utilizzando qualsiasi metodo.

Conclusione

Esistono quattro modi per svuotare i file di registro di sistema: uno è usando "troncare"Comando per modificare la dimensione del file in 0kb, Un altro è il passaggio all'utente di root e quindi svuotando il file utilizzando ">"Comando. Poi abbiamo "Echo>"Comando e infine, abbiamo"/dev/null"Comando.